#110524 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#110524 is composed of 6.7% red, 2%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 85.9% black. It has a hue angle of 263.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 8%. #110524 color hex could be obtained by blending #220a48 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#110524 color description : Very dark (mostly black) violet.
#110524 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#110524 has RGB values of R:17, G:5,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 1115428.

Shades and Tints of #110524
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f5effd is the lightest one.

Tones of #110524
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#141316 is the less saturated color, while #100029 is the most saturated one.
